Its nothing particularly special just a cortexm4 based lm4f120 mcu at up to 80 mhz with 256 kib of flash and 32 kib of sram, an rgb led and an onboard usb programmer but its pretty cheap and ive gotten to know it quite well. Stellaristiva launchpad uext interface board features ti launchpad boosterpack xl female headers two uext connectors they use spi, i2c and uart smd jumpers provided for swapping rxtx of both uarts dimensions. The arduino ethernet shield is built around the wiznet w5100. Iot solutions with the tiva c series connected launchpad. Arm cortexm4f based mcu tm4c123g launchpad evaluation kit. The idea is that useful functionality will be moved out into separate crates. Another amazing feature of the microcontroller is that it supports floating point unitfpu. I chose the ti stellaris launchpad since i already had one. Mar 28, 2014 texas instruments tiva c series tm4c1294 connected launchpad is an evaluation kit for the internet of things with a cortexm4 mcu tiva tm4c1294, an ethernet port, and usb interfaces for power and debugging. Arm cortexm4fbased mcu tm4c1294 connected launchpad. Click mac address mode option from the user register programming utility. Installing launchpad drivers with energia on windows. Stellaris arm cortexm microcontrollers software stellarisware software stellarisware software is an extensive suite of software designed to simplify and. Now is on preorder status with a 1012 weeks delivery time.
The msp432 is similar to the stellaris lm4f120 and tivac tm4c123 parts. Tm4c123g launchpad driver problems texas instruments. Now if you dont want to do that sleuthing yourself you can head on over to the gcc with ti stellaris launchpad. Eklm4f120xl stellaris lm4f120 launchpad evaluation kit. Its the newly launched texas instruments stellaris launchpad. This fantastic board features two lx4f120h5qr arm cortex m4 with floating point, one as icd and one as target, two user switches and one rgb led driven by 3 transistors the target clock oscillator is build with y1 32k768 and y2 16mhz osc. Getting started with the tiva tm4c123g launchpad workshop. This wiki page describes how first robotics teams can use either launchpad in the first robotics competition frc. Everything had been going swimmingly until joonas reached the fourth tutorial on interrupts. The tm4c1294 connected launchpad evaluation kit is a lowcost development platform for arm cortexm4fbased microcontrollers. Select your board select tm4c1294xl launchpad from the quick set pulldown menu under the configuration tab click on the other utilities tab. Texas instruments tiva c series tm4c129x microcontrollers is available at mouser. I had a lot of ge plc parts laying around but no decent cpu to control them. Well i finally got my arduino duemilanove and prototype shields, there should be a ethernet shield, and a lcd shield on its way.
Resolved unable to install stellaris icdi drivers in. If you are interested in my professional work as embedded software developer, please email me. It carries a single mikrobus host socket, therefore bringing enormous flexibility and seamless integration of the plugandplay click boards to your launchpad. Buy texas instruments eklm4f120xl eval board, stellaris lm4f120 launchpad.
A simple example that uses the tirtos spi driver to cycle through a neopixel ring 24 from adafruit. Ive just noticed that the ads1118 booster packs j4 connector has long pins extending below the pcb, and one of them can contact the top of the vdd jumper. Armed with that and the short stellaris lm4f120 launchpad evaluation board. Tis eklm4f120xl evaluation module evaluation board helps move your designs. This package includes the latest version of the tivaware for c series driver library, usb library. Realtime interfacing to arm cortex m microcontrollers sixth printinh new 122017 available from amazon ebook. Arduino trials and tribulations, part 1 april 30, 2011 posted by phoenixcomm in 16 segment driver, arduino, diy aircraft cockpit, flight simulation, linux, ps2 keybaord, software. Oct 11, 2012 ti allows use of the full version of their ide, code composer studio, with the launchpads onboard debugger. In this video i will show you how to set up the development environment for the rest of series. Then click get current mac address button to read the mac address from the board. The sweklm4f120xl package contains the stellarisware release for the stellaris lm4f120 launchpad eklm4f120xl.
Simulink embedded coder target for ti stellaris launchpad. I was really impressed by the getting started handson workshop offered in tis wiki. The stellaris launchpad from texas instruments, arm. This video provides guidelines for using ethernet controller on the new tiva.
Using the stellaris or tiva c series launchpad in the. Getting started with the stellaris eklm4f120xl launchpad. Dec 02, 2012 stellaris lm4f120 launchpad evaluation board or the best bucks you ever spent. This package includes the latest version of the stellarisware driver library. Stellaris launchpad lm4f120 code texas instruments. After these two steps are complete then you follow these directions to install drivers for the launchpad. Welcome to the first video of many arm cortexm programming tutorials. It works with texas instruments graphics library and uses ssd1289 lcd driver for 3,2 320x240 screen and analog signals for touch ti graphics library uses analog signals. This page shows how to interface the board to a can bus. Subteam of graphics drivers is a member of these teams. Texas instruments launchpad evaluation kits are available for a broad range of ti microcontrollers, including msp430, msp432, wireless mcus, c2000, tiva c and hercules. The new one will have 256kb or program memory plus 16kb of ram. This package includes the latest version of the stellarisware driver library, usb library, and graphics library.
The stellaris lm4f120 launchpad evaluation board is a lowcost evaluation platform. An example to detect a usb disconnect event on a tiva c launchpad. When i now tried accessing any information on the lm4f120 series at ti, anything related to it seems to have disappeared and old links are redirected to the tm4c123 series. Getting started with the stellaris eklm4f120xl launchpad workshop initialization 3 3 stellarisware peripheral driver library graphics library usb library ethernet stacks insystem programming licensefree and royaltyfree source code for ti cortexm devices. The stellaris launchpad is almost functionally identical to the tiva c series launchpad. Ive purchased one via ti estore, and already received it. The next dialog, select the processors that your ccs installation will support. You can go further with the tutorials and ccs etc from texas instruments own pages. Oct 31, 2012 joonas has been following tis getting started tutorials for their new stellaris launchpad. The stellaris lm4f120 launchpad evaluation kit is a lowcost evaluation platform for arm cortexm4fbased microcontrollers from texas instruments. Tiva c series tm4c129x ethernet overview ti digikey.
After receiving my stellaris launchpad, i decided to browse the little amount of tutorials there was available on the subject. Tiva c series tm4c129x mcu guidelines for ethernet. This team does not use launchpad to host a mailing list. Create bluetooth projects using ti cc2640r2f launchpad online course, adding bluetooth connectivity to dps3005 programmable power supply using ti cc2640r2f ble mcu, bluetooth low energy point of sale using ti cc2652rb simplelink crystalless baw wireless mcu, ti cc2640r2f eddystone beacon, bluetooth low energy game. By using driver library apis in stellarisware and tivaware for c series mcus, software can be easily. Select your board select tm4c1294xl launchpad from the quick set pulldown menu under the configuration tab. However to take full advantage of the board, consider going back to the ti tools and move forward with them. Run this step only if your device drivers did not install properly. The design of the stellaris launchpad highlights the lm4f120h5qr microcontroller with a usb 2. Software description and features provided along with supporting documentation and resources. The stellaris lm4f120 launchpad evaluation board is a lowcost evaluation platform for arm cortexm4fbased microcontrollers from texas instruments. Arduino, hardware, icm7243, max6955, software add a comment. Ti allows use of the full version of their ide, code composer studio, with the launchpads onboard debugger. You should select stellaris cortex m mcus in order to run the labs in this workshop.
All content and materials on this site are provided as is. Some launchpad uses different method of building sketches. December 2, 2012 posted by phoenixcomm in arduino, diy aircraft cockpit, flight simulation, linux, ps2 keybaord, software, ti cortexa8 cpu, ti eklm4f120xl launchpad, ti stellaris. It is in the process of being replaced by the rebranded tiva c series. Oct 18, 2014 welcome to the first video of many arm cortexm programming tutorials.
From fundamentals to deep dives, our online video tutorials help you design and develop with ti products, tools, software and applications. Tcp driver for stellaris launchpad tm4c1294ncpdt freertos. A problem occurred while attempting to add the driver to the store. Stellaris lm4f120 launchpad lowcost evaluation kit wired. On the tm4c1294 devices, the ethernet mac address will be erased by the. Installing stellaris board drivers austin blackstone.
Here is the touch lcd boosterpack for tiva, stellaris and hercules launchpad. Ti home semiconductors design resources stellaris icdi drivers. The stellaris lm4f120 launchpad evaluation board is a lowcost evaluation platform for arm. Ti ads1118 booster pack and stellaris launchpad possible. Methods to prevent or control esd exposure of the tiva c series.
Ti stellaris launchpad evaluation kit unboxing ive finally received from texas instruments the stellaris launchpad evaluation kit it was 4. Tirtos ethernet driver needs api for determining link status. Many stellaris evaluation kits come with an integrated stellaris incircuit debug interface icdi which allows for the. Tis crosscompatible portfolio of modular evaluation and development hardware pair perfectly with scalable online and offline software to help you get your products to market faster. Using the stellaris or tiva c series launchpad in the first. Getting started with the ti stellaris launchpad on linux.
While they are not drivers in the pure operating system sense that is, they do not have a common interface. This package includes the latest version of the tivaware for c series driver library, usb library, and graphics library. Twopart presentation on trends in bathis twopart presentations discusses current and future trends in battery technology, specifically how choices in materials affect voltages and battery capacity, e. A while ago i got a stellaris launchpad for the new lm4f120 mcu but did not get around to trying it out. If you have used the mspexp4321r lauchpad using texas instruments ccscode composer studio probably you have already the driver. Texas instruments tiva c series connected launchpad.
Raspberry pi, ti stellaris launchpad, stmdiscovery these are mainly hobby projects. The stellaris lm4f120 launchpad is still available at the texas instruments estore, but not for long. Hacking the navigation computer display june 6, 20 posted by phoenixcomm in 16 segment driver, aircraft, arduino, cp1252asn128, diy aircraft cockpit, embedded cpus, ethernet, flight simulation, hardware, indicator lamps, multi function display, ps2 keybaord, semiconductors. Eklm4f120xl stellaris lm4f120 launchpad evaluation kit ti. Arduino, diy cockpit, flight simulation, hardware, lunix, software, stellaris. Unable to install stellaris icdi drivers in windows 10 for tiva c series tm4c1294ncpdt launchpad.
The bsdlicensed header file for the launchpads microprocessor lm4f120h5qr is included in this project. The tiva c series tm4c123g launchpad evaluation kit. Mrmobilewill 10032012 arm, microcontrollers, ti leave a comment. The computeraided design cad files and all associated content posted to this website are created, uploaded, managed and owned by third party users. Getting started with the stellaris eklm4f120xl launchpad workshop introduction 1 11 6. This program allows you to test the launchpad board and also try out some of the features of the lm4f120 mcu that is present in the board. It looks like a possible short could occur between these two points. Texas instruments tiva c series tm4c1294 connected launchpad is an evaluation kit for the internet of things with a cortexm4 mcu tiva tm4c1294, an ethernet port, and usb interfaces for power and debugging. This is a evaluation platform for arm cortexm4fbased microcontrollers featuring the newest tm4c123gh6pm with a usb 2. Getting started with the stellaris launchpad hackaday.
The msp432 is a mixedsignal microcontroller family from texas instruments. A bare metal example program written in rust for the stellaris launchpad lm4f120 dev board. For more specific information about the tiva c series launchpad please visit the product page. Ti expanded the family with higher performance parts containing ethernet. The simplest way to get these installed is to plug in the stellaris launchpad make sure you plug into the debug usb port and the switch is flipped to the right, the automatic windows driver installation will fail, at this point you will need to go to device manager and manually update the three drivers that. The click booster pack is an adapter extension for the texas instruments stellaris lm4f120 launchpad or tiva tm4c123g launchpad. After watching the first few tutorials, i had a somewhat firmer grasp on how this little puppy was supposed to be programmed, and the capabilities of the code composer studio ide. Now i just have to go get all the software packages needed for launchpad development that i lost when i reinstalled winblows. The guys at ti were generous enough to include working quickstart driver installation guide with the package, and for once, i was actually able to walk through it without any oh this doesnt work anymore moments. It is tempting me btw, do u have all additional hw components, particularly the touch lcd. The chip provides a complete tcpip stack and can ethernet. Instructions on how to add wifi to a tirtos project. Tiva c series tm4c129x mcu guidelines for ethernet youtube. If didnt install the ccs then just follow the instructions below.
The tiva series launchpad is a lowcost development platform for arm cortexm4f based microcontrollers. All you need is the flash tool lm4tools and a compiler and theres a shell script that will fetch both of those for you. The preregistered stellaris launchpad version was 4. In the icdi folder you will find all the drivers you will need for your board.
At the time of writing we found an i2c library as well. Texas instruments stellaris lm3s9d90 user manual pdf. Tiva c series evaluation and reference design kits provide an integrated in circuit debug interface icdi which allows programming and debugging of the. May also work on the very closely related tivac tm4c123 launchpad. Theres a growing energiastellaris forum, and libraries can be found here. Stellaris lm4f120 launchpad evaluation board or the best bucks you ever spent. Analog design journal technical documents technical articles thirdparty network. Ive had a few projects over the past few years using the ti stellaris launchpad. These lowcost kits provide developers with everything they need to start designing new applications. The user manual for the lm4f120 launchpad evaluation board is still available, as is the stellarisware software. Porting the arduino driver code to the launchpad should be fairly straightforward, youll need spi and a few control lines. The original cpu was an 8051 running at 2mhz with 4kb of program memory. Ti and its respective suppliers and providers of content make no representations about the suitability of these materials for any purpose and disclaim all warranties and conditions with regard to these materials, including but not limited to all implied warranties and conditions of merchantability, fitness for a particular purpose.
Oct 09, 2012 read about free stellarisware software etc. The microcontroller cant be connected directly to a can bus, a can bus transceiver is needed. Adc12 initialization and gpio synchronous serial interface. If not, i will attempt to write one and contribute to freertos. Tiva c series tm4c123g launchpad evaluation kit readme first rev. To work with stellaris microcontrollers, youll also need to grab stellarisware. Can interface for stellaris launchpad the arm cortex m4 controller on the stellaris launchpad includes a can module. Standalone insystemprogrammer to flash avrs without a pc. Stm32 microcontrollers are very nice and the stm32f0 stm32vl stm32f3 stm32f4 stm32l discovery boards with the integrated debugger are well supported under linux, in contrast to the lpcxpresso boards from nxp, so in principle there is no need to look further for other microcontrollers but i like trying new stuff and bought two cheep eklm4f120xl stellaris lm4f120 launchpad. I am trying to find out if there are plans for higherlevel mware style driver library apis part of tirtos perhaps for either f28027 or f28069 piccolo in the works. Each tiva board consists of a target microcontroller, an incircuit debug interface icdi such as jtag, a regulated power supply, and a set of expansion headers.
Introduction to arm cortex m microcontrollers sixth printing new 12019 available from amazon ebook, volume 2 embedded systems. Hello, im trying to install the icd drivers for stellaris launchpad on my windows 8, but i get this error. How to install windows drivers for the launchpad on windows 10. It seems i need a certificate for this driver, but i cant find this file on the stellaris driver foulder. Stellarisware release for the stellaris lm4f120 launchpad eklm4f120xl. Follow the driver installation instructions and plug in the usb cable into the launchpad s debug usb port and your computer when the instructions tell you to. In addition this presentation will give a technical overview of the integrated ethernet controller and be well versed on how to use the ethernet controller to add connectivity to embedded processing applications using tiva c series tm4c129x microcontrollers. Hardware there are a couple of can bus transceivers from different manufactures. I then followed the instructions for stellaris driver installation. Texas instruments tiva c series connected launchpad unboxing. It also includes several complete example applications for the stellaris launchpad. However, the datasheets for the lm4f120 arm processors. Add displays, wifi, zigbee or bluetooth transceivers, gsm or gps modules, ethernet modules, sensors. Ti stellaris launchpad 3d cad model library grabcad.
1162 578 1074 1026 364 816 782 864 540 761 834 312 82 15 142 806 517 641 267 587 796 1536 168 742 1344 1069 937 433 458 211 377 360 762 723 362 1466 21 893 376 171 479 1356 881 784 1251 1074 1486